Summary

Reinforced concrete (RC) piers have been widely studied and applied in bridge construction practice. To ensure the normal operation of RC piers under corrosive environments and seismic effects, new corrosion-resistant materials with good mechanical properties need to be introduced. In this study, fiber reinforced polymer (FRP), engineered cementitious composite (ECC), and stainless steel plates were used in concrete piers for the first time, introducing a novel concrete pier reinforced with FRP confined ECC core (FCEC). A spiral stirrup confined and three stainless steel plate confined concrete piers reinforced with different FCEC heights were constructed, and a quasi-static test was performed to assess their seismic performance. For comparison, a conventional RC pier was also tested. The analysis focused on the failure modes and hysteresis behavior of the specimens. The test results indicated that plastic hinges formed at the pier base of all specimens, except for the concrete pier reinforced with 250mm-height FCEC. The concrete piers reinforced with FCEC demonstrated higher load-bearing capacity but lower ductility than the conventional RC piers. Interestingly, a reduction in FCEC height was found to enhance the ductility of these novel concrete piers. To support effective design practices for concrete piers reinforced with FCEC, a simplified bearing capacity calculation model and an appropriate FCEC height calculation model were developed based on experimental findings and mechanical analysis.
